Inspired by Southern Utah’s pioneering dining roots and hearty fare, Executive Chef Shon Foster showcases a thoughtfully curated seasonal menu that speaks to the history of St. George and heritage of Utah. Small plates and “starters” are paired with signature shareable entrees sourced from local and regional farmers and artisans and responsibly sourced fish and seafood.
